Interesting.. IN the March 2006 issue of Linux magazine, they have a DVD with a version of the LinEx (http://www.linex.org) distro called "Extreme Gaming" Anyone installed this specific distro? I'm gonna attempt it tonight, and have it dual boot with Ubuntu.

site linked is in Spanish, and seems to be the official linux distribution of the Extremadura regional government of Spain.

The point is that Linux Magazine has a version of it with 150 different games loaded by default...

Finally got it installed, and I have to say this is a great distro for the gamer. As this is Gnome-based, it should be familiar to the average Ubuntu user.

I really liked the graphical installer, andd I have to say that some of the 150+ games on here that I can't run on Ubuntu for some reason (Like BZFlag) runs perfectly on here.

I have no plans on abandoning Ubuntu , but for gaming, I think I'm going to boot into Juega LinEx. I'll try finding a torrent for it a bit later, for those who may be interested in it.
